1.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T)

Overview

Located in Cambridge, Massachusetts, MIT is renowned for its emphasis on science, engineering, and technology. Established in 1861, it has consistently topped global rankings due to its pioneering research, innovative teaching methods, and contributions to technology and industry.

Academic Excellence

MIT’s academic programs span a wide range of disciplines, including engineering, computer science, economics, and management. The university’s research initiatives often lead to groundbreaking discoveries and technological advancements. MIT’s faculty includes numerous Nobel laureates, MacArthur fellows, and members of prestigious academies.

Campus Life and Facilities

MIT’s campus is equipped with state-of-the-art laboratories, research centers, and collaborative spaces. Students benefit from a strong entrepreneurial ecosystem, including the Martin Trust Center for MIT Entrepreneurship. The university’s vibrant student life includes numerous clubs, organizations, and events that foster a dynamic community.

2. Stanford University

Overview

Stanford University, located in Stanford, California, is synonymous with innovation and academic excellence. Founded in 1885, Stanford is known for its proximity to Silicon Valley, which significantly influences its programs and research initiatives.

Academic Excellence

Stanford excels in a variety of fields, including business, law, medicine, and the sciences. The university is particularly renowned for its entrepreneurial spirit and strong connections with the tech industry. Stanford’s research output and academic reputation consistently place it among the top universities globally.

Campus Life and Facilities

Stanford’s sprawling campus features cutting-edge research facilities, including the Stanford Linear Accelerator Center and the Hoover Institution. The university offers a rich campus life with a variety of student organizations, cultural events, and recreational activities. The Stanford community benefits from its beautiful campus and strong emphasis on student well-being.

3. Harvard University

Overview

Harvard University, located in Cambridge, Massachusetts, is one of the oldest and most prestigious institutions in the world, founded in 1636. It is renowned for its rigorous academics, distinguished faculty, and extensive alumni network.

Academic Excellence

Harvard offers a diverse array of programs across its undergraduate, graduate, and professional schools. It is particularly known for its strong programs in law, business, medicine, and the humanities. Harvard’s research initiatives are supported by substantial funding and resources, contributing to its status as a global leader in education.

Campus Life and Facilities

Harvard’s historic campus features a blend of traditional and modern architecture, with facilities like the Widener Library and the Harvard Art Museums. Student life at Harvard is enriched by numerous cultural and academic events, a wide range of student organizations, and a strong sense of community.

4. California Institute of Technology (Caltech)

Overview

Located in Pasadena, California, Caltech is renowned for its focus on science and engineering. Established in 1891, Caltech is a leading research institution with a strong emphasis on innovation and discovery.

Academic Excellence

Caltech’s programs are particularly strong in the fields of physics, chemistry, biology, and engineering. The institute’s research facilities are among the best in the world, and its faculty includes several Nobel Prize winners and other eminent scientists.

Campus Life and Facilities

Caltech’s campus is known for its intimate and collaborative environment. Students have access to cutting-edge research facilities and are encouraged to engage in interdisciplinary projects. The institute fosters a close-knit community with a focus on academic and personal development.

5. University of Chicago

Overview

The University of Chicago, located in Chicago, Illinois, is renowned for its rigorous academic programs and commitment to research. Founded in 1890, the university has made significant contributions to various fields, including economics, law, and social sciences.

Academic Excellence

The University of Chicago is known for its strong programs in economics, law, and business, as well as its commitment to interdisciplinary research. The university’s faculty includes numerous Nobel laureates and other distinguished scholars.

Campus Life and Facilities

The university’s campus features a blend of historic and modern architecture, with facilities such as the Joe and Rika Mansueto Library and the Becker Friedman Institute for Research in Economics. Student life at the University of Chicago includes a range of academic, cultural, and recreational activities.

6. Princeton University

Overview

Princeton University, located in Princeton, New Jersey, is known for its strong liberal arts programs and commitment to undergraduate education. Founded in 1746, Princeton is one of the oldest universities in the U.S. and has a long tradition of academic excellence.

Academic Excellence

Princeton is particularly renowned for its programs in the humanities, social sciences, and natural sciences. The university’s commitment to undergraduate education ensures that students receive personalized attention and engage in meaningful research opportunities.

Campus Life and Facilities

Princeton’s picturesque campus features historic buildings, modern research facilities, and extensive libraries. The university offers a rich campus life with numerous student organizations, cultural events, and recreational activities.

7. University of Pennsylvania

Overview

The University of Pennsylvania, located in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, is a prestigious Ivy League institution founded in 1740. Penn is known for its interdisciplinary approach to education and its strong programs in business, law, and medicine.

Academic Excellence

Penn’s programs in business, law, and medicine are particularly well-regarded, with the Wharton School being one of the leading business schools in the world. The university’s research initiatives span a wide range of disciplines, contributing to its global reputation.

Campus Life and Facilities

Penn’s urban campus features a mix of historic and modern buildings, with facilities such as the Penn Museum and the Perelman School of Medicine. Student life at Penn is vibrant, with numerous cultural, academic, and recreational opportunities.

8. Columbia University

Overview

Columbia University, located in New York City, is an Ivy League institution founded in 1754. Known for its strong academic programs and influential research, Columbia is a leading center of higher education.

Academic Excellence

Columbia is renowned for its programs in business, law, journalism, and the humanities. The university’s research initiatives are supported by significant funding, and its faculty includes numerous Nobel Prize winners and other distinguished scholars.

Campus Life and Facilities

Columbia’s urban campus is integrated into the vibrant city of New York, providing students with unique cultural and professional opportunities. The university’s facilities include the Butler Library and the Irving Medical Center. Student life is enriched by a diverse range of activities, organizations, and events.

9. Yale University

Overview

Yale University, located in New Haven, Connecticut, is one of the oldest and most prestigious universities in the U.S., founded in 1701. Yale is known for its strong liberal arts programs and commitment to research and scholarship.

Academic Excellence

Yale’s programs in law, business, and the humanities are particularly well-regarded. The university’s research initiatives span a wide range of disciplines, and its faculty includes numerous eminent scholars and researchers.

Campus Life and Facilities

Yale’s historic campus features iconic buildings such as the Sterling Memorial Library and the Yale Art Gallery. Student life at Yale is vibrant, with a strong sense of community and numerous academic, cultural, and recreational activities.

10. University of California, Berkeley

Overview

The University of California, Berkeley, located in Berkeley, California, is a leading public research university founded in 1868. Known for its commitment to academic excellence and social justice, UC Berkeley is a prominent center of research and innovation.

Academic Excellence

UC Berkeley is renowned for its programs in engineering, computer science, and social sciences. The university’s research initiatives are supported by significant funding, and its faculty includes numerous Nobel laureates and other distinguished scholars.

Campus Life and Facilities

The campus features a blend of historic and modern buildings, with facilities such as the Berkeley Art Museum and Pacific Film Archive. Student life at UC Berkeley includes a range of academic, cultural, and recreational activities, fostering a dynamic and inclusive community.
